Why do organizations use TAXII for threat intelligence instead of sending indicators in ad hoc formats?

← Back to all FAQ
By NHI Mgmt Group Editorial Team Updated September 19, 2026 Domain: Cyber Security

Organizations use TAXII because it creates a consistent exchange layer for threat intelligence. Instead of each team or tool inventing its own format, TAXII lets producers and consumers share anonymized indicators, malware intelligence, and suspicious activity through defined services. That reduces friction, supports collaboration, and makes it easier to collect, query, and distribute intelligence across environments.

Why TAXII Works Better Than Ad Hoc Indicator Sharing

TAXII helps because threat intelligence only becomes useful at scale when both sides can agree on how to package, move, query, and version it. Ad hoc sharing tends to break down on schema drift, manual reformatting, and tool-specific assumptions, which makes intelligence harder to trust and harder to reuse across teams, platforms, and partners.

That matters most when the same indicator needs to move between SOC tooling, external partners, and internal consumers with different workflows. A consistent exchange layer reduces translation work, preserves context around the indicator, and makes automated handling much more reliable than one-off email, chat, or custom API formats.

Organizations also use TAXII to separate the intelligence content from the transport mechanism. That distinction is important because the producer can publish structured collections and the consumer can subscribe, poll, or retrieve what it needs without negotiating a new format every time the relationship changes. For practitioners, that lowers integration cost and makes sharing easier to operationalize.

In practice, the value is less about the protocol name and more about repeatability. If a team can query intelligence the same way every time, it can automate ingestion, deduplicate feeds, and reduce human handling errors. If it cannot, every new partner or tool becomes a bespoke integration project.

What TAXII Changes Operationally

TAXII is most useful when intelligence must be exchanged across boundaries without losing structure or meaning. It standardizes the request and delivery pattern for indicators, malware-related intelligence, and suspicious activity so that consumers can collect what they need in a predictable way, rather than reverse-engineering each provider’s output.

That predictability supports three practical outcomes. First, it improves interoperability because different tools can ingest the same service. Second, it improves timeliness because collection can be automated rather than manually repackaged. Third, it improves consistency because the same intelligence can be distributed to multiple environments without each recipient applying a different local transformation.

For teams building a threat intelligence program, this also helps with governance. A standardized exchange layer makes it easier to define who can publish, who can consume, what collections are exposed, and how updates propagate. Those control points matter when intelligence is shared internally, with managed service providers, or with external partners who need controlled access to curated feeds.

Practitioner Guidance

What to verify: Confirm that your TAXII collections are aligned to a defined consumer need, not just a feed dump. If recipients cannot explain what they will do with the collection, the integration is probably too broad or too noisy to be operationally useful.

What to prioritise: Prioritise stable schema, clear collection ownership, and refresh cadence before you add more sources. A smaller well-governed TAXII exchange is usually more valuable than a larger set of ad hoc feeds that nobody trusts or can automate reliably.

Common mistake: Treating TAXII as a magic intelligence quality layer. It improves exchange and automation, but it does not fix poor indicator quality, stale enrichment, or weak attribution. If the source data is unreliable, a standard transport only helps you distribute bad intelligence more efficiently.

Practitioner takeaway: Use TAXII when you need intelligence to be machine-consumable, reusable, and governable across multiple consumers. If the sharing pattern is still one-off and human-mediated, the protocol benefit is limited; if the exchange must scale, standardisation is the real control.
